Tony White, whose 30+ year career in animation has included work on the title sequence for The Pink Panther Strikes Again (among other things), has written a new book entitled, "Animation from Pencils to Pixels: Classical Techniques for the Digital Animator", which was released with an accompanying instructional DVD in July of this year...
